Transaction 3923fac464a2d12521544fbca075c37dabd93dc8f05050a16394ed331310bc46
1 Input
1 Output
-
3923fac464a2d12521544fbca075c37dabd93dc8f05050a16394ed331310bc46:0
- value
- 2508655
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e48d4d5820e0d15f39b17b37a6f35704a7d27e2
- address
- bc1qpeydf4vzpcx3tuumz7eh5me4wp986flzk2taxv